Region merging with topological control
This paper presents a region merging process controlled by topological features on regions in 3D images. Betti numbers, a well-known topological invariant, are used as criteria. Classical and incremental algorithms to compute Betti numbers using information represented by the topological map of an image are provided. When multiple robots cooperatively explore an environment, maps from individual robots must be merged to produce a single globally consistent map. This is a difficult problem when the robots do not have a common reference frame or global positioning. In this paper, we describe an algorithm for merging embedded topological maps. Segmentation is the division of an image into a number of contained self-consistent regions. Each region must be homogeneous with respect to a particular property such as intensity, colour or texture. Ideally the regions will clearly relate to distinct elements or objects within the scene. The topological map is a model that represents 2D and 3D images subdivision. It aims to allow the use of topological and geometrical features of the subdivision in image processing operations. When handling regions in an image, one of the main operation is the region merging, for example in segmentation process. In this paper, we discuss the use of graph-cuts to merge the regions of the watershed transform optimally. Watershed is a simple, intuitive and efficient way of segmenting an image. Unfortunately it presents a few limitations such as over-segmentation and poor detection of low boundaries.
